A Digital Signature Certificate (DSC) is the cryptographic equivalent of a handwritten signature — issued under the Information Technology Act 2000 by Licensed Certifying Authorities (CAs) accredited by the Controller of Certifying Authorities (CCA), Government of India. Following the harmonisation under CCA's revised guidelines (effective 1 January 2021), India now operates a single class — Class 3 DSC — for all digital signing requirements, replacing the earlier Class 2 / Class 3 distinction. A valid Class 3 DSC, hosted on a secure FIPS 140-2 compliant USB token (ePass / Watchdata / mToken / Hyp2003), provides the authenticity, integrity, and non-repudiation needed for filings on the MCA21 portal, Income Tax e-filing portal, GST portal, EPFO, ESIC, ICEGATE, DGFT, e-Tendering portals (CPP-Portal, GeM, Indian Railways, defence PSUs), TRACES, RBI portals, IRDAI, SEBI, and MahaRERA / state RERA portals.

Key DSC Concepts You Must Know

Class 3

Single Unified Class

Effective 1 Jan 2021, Class 2 was discontinued; Class 3 is the single class for all e-filings, e-tenders, and document signing. Highest assurance level under CCA framework.

Sign vs Encrypt

Sign-Only vs Sign + Encrypt

Sign-only DSC for signing documents; Sign + Encrypt (combo) DSC for signing + encrypting communications — useful for e-tendering and secure email.

USB Token

FIPS 140-2 Crypto Token

Private key never leaves the FIPS 140-2 certified USB token (ePass2003, Watchdata, mToken, Hyp2003) — providing tamper-resistance and non-repudiation.

Video Verification

Video KYC Recording

Mandatory video-recording verification per CCA — applicant reads PIN code & Aadhaar last digits on camera, stored as audit evidence by CA.

Revocation

CRL / OCSP Status

Revoked DSCs are listed in the Certificate Revocation List (CRL) and queryable via OCSP — relying portals reject signatures from revoked / expired DSCs.

FAQs on Digital Signature Certificate

What is a Digital Signature Certificate (DSC)?
A DSC is the electronic equivalent of a handwritten signature, issued by Licensed Certifying Authorities under the IT Act 2000. It provides authenticity, integrity, and non-repudiation for documents and filings on government and corporate portals.
What is the difference between Class 2 and Class 3 DSC?
Effective 1 January 2021, Class 2 DSC has been discontinued by the CCA. Class 3 is now the single unified class for all use cases — MCA filings, GST, ITR, e-tendering, and document signing.
How long does it take to get a DSC?
With Aadhaar e-KYC, individual DSC is typically issued in 30–60 minutes. Organisation DSC and Foreign National DSC may take 1–3 working days depending on KYC documentation and verification.
What is the validity of a DSC?
DSCs are issued for 1, 2, or 3 years — the most common is 2 years. Renewal must be completed before expiry; expired DSCs cannot sign and must be re-issued through fresh KYC.
Can DSC be used on Mac and Linux?
Yes. USB tokens like ePass2003, Watchdata, and Hyp2003 have drivers for Windows, macOS, and Linux. Some government portals are best supported on Windows, but most filings work on all three platforms with correct driver and Java configuration.
What is a Document Signer Certificate?
A Document Signer is an organisation-bound DSC hosted on a Hardware Security Module (HSM) for automated, server-side bulk signing — used for e-invoicing, e-way bills, payroll, certificates, and policy documents without needing a USB token.
What if I lose my DSC token or forget the PIN?
A lost token / forgotten PIN cannot be recovered — the DSC must be revoked and a fresh DSC issued. Always store the token securely and remember the PIN; some tokens permanently lock after a few wrong attempts.
